Enzymes speed up chemical reactions by lowering the activation energy required. They do not start reactions, but rather hasten reactions that would occur eventually. Enzymes specifically bind to substrates at their active site. Each enzyme only works on one specific substrate that fits its active site shape like a lock and key.
